Mountain Lake Acquisition Corp. II Class A Ordinary Shares
FINANCIAL SERVICES · SHELL COMPANIES · USA
Mountain Lake Acquisition Corp. II (MLAA) is a special purpose acquisition company focused on merging with high-growth companies across a range of sectors. Leveraging a seasoned management team with deep industry connections, MLAA aims to identify and acquire innovative businesses positioned for long-term success.
